  • I recently started to use my phone to monitor the conditions of my plant collection with a couple of Sensorpush devices. They report temperature, humidity, barometric pressure, and vapor pressure once a minute via Bluetooth, and I get a notification if conditions deviate from what I set. It has been very helpful at dialing in things in and responding to problems.

  • DMT is not orally active unless you're on a MAOI, which is dangerous and could potentially explain the symptoms being described. I wouldn't trust any chocolate being sold as both psychoactive and containing DMT. You're either getting ripped off or taking something potentially very dangerous.
